Cebu girl, 7, held hostage

- Niña G. Sumacot-Abenoja - The Philippine Star

CEBU CITY, Philippines  – Police rescued an eight-year-old girl who was held hostage by a 25-year-old laborer believed to be suffering from depression in Barangay Apas here yesterday morning.

The hostage crisis lasted for almost two hours and Cebu City police chief Melvin Ramon Buenafe himself undertook the negotiations until suspect Paul Guigue gave in and released the girl.

According to neighbors, the girl, a Grade 2 pupil at the Barrio Luz Elementary School, was playing outside her house when Guigue, wielding a pair of scissors and an improvised ice pick, suddenly grabbed her.

Police arrived and surrounded Guigue. Buenafe later arrived and handled the negotiations.

Guigue later told reporters that he took the girl hostage because someone was trying to kill him and his family, adding though that he had no intentions of killing the girl.

Guigue admitted that he sniffed solvent and drank liquor when he was still in his hometown of Panglao in Bohol.

Buenafe said they would subject Guigue to psychiatric evaluation first before deciding on filing charges against him. – Freeman News Service
